The Rise of Niche Gaming Platforms and Data Privacy Concerns

Over the past decade, the proliferation of niche online games—ranging from fishing simulators to specialized sports betting sites—has introduced complex data handling challenges. For example, it is estimated that over 70% of online gaming websites now collect analytics data to optimize game mechanics and user engagement, often involving third-party tracking services. While these insights can foster engaging experiences, they heighten the risk of data misuse and breach if not governed by transparent policies.

In fishing gaming platforms, user interaction data often includes location, device specifics, and even financial transactions, especially if the platform offers real-money betting or in-game purchases. The dual necessity of maximizing engagement while maintaining high privacy standards underscores the need for well-articulated privacy policies that clarify data handling practices, recipients, and user rights.

Key Elements of a Robust Privacy Policy in Gaming Platforms
Component Description
Data Collection Scope Details on what types of personal and behavioral data are collected, including mandatory vs. optional disclosures.
Usage & Purpose Explicit explanations about how user data is used for game improvement, marketing, and third-party integrations.
Sharing & Third-Party Access Information about data sharing practices with subsidiaries, affiliates, or service providers.
User Rights & Controls Guidance on how users can access, update, or delete their data, and opt out of certain uses.
Security Measures Description of technical and organizational safeguards implemented to prevent unauthorized data access.
